Optimized Solar Harvesting


The integrated MPPT 160A (or 120A depending on model) solar charge controller is a key feature. MPPT stands for Maximum Power Point Tracking, a technology that optimizes power extraction from solar PV arrays. This maximizes energy harvest.

By dynamically adjusting its input voltage to match the solar panel's maximum power point, the controller ensures that every available watt is captured. This is especially beneficial during varying light conditions, such as cloudy days or early mornings. More power reaches the batteries.

Unlike older PWM (Pulse Width Modulation) controllers, which are less efficient, MPPT technology can increase charge efficiency by 15-30%. This translates directly into more usable energy from the same solar array, a critical factor for self-sustaining energy systems. Efficiency is paramount.

Seamless Energy Integration


This hybrid inverter supports 500VDC PV input voltage, allowing for longer series strings of solar panels. Higher voltage strings reduce current, minimizing wire losses and simplifying wiring. This design improves system efficiency.

The ability to handle higher PV input voltages means users can design their solar arrays with fewer parallel strings, potentially reducing the number of combiner boxes and associated wiring. Installation becomes more manageable. This is a practical benefit.

Many entry-level inverters have lower PV input voltage limits, forcing more complex parallel wiring or smaller array sizes. This ECGSOLAX unit offers greater flexibility in array design and scalability, accommodating larger or more efficient panel configurations. It offers significant scalability.
